Metro to shut service 3 hrs early on Diwali

On account of 'Bhai Duj' on Sunday,Metro will run 33 extra trains which will make as many as 453 additional trips.

Metro services in the national capital will close three hours before normal time on Friday on the Diwali day,the Delhi Metro Rail Corporation said on Wednesday.

On account of ‘Bhai Duj’ on Sunday,Delhi Metro will run 33 extra trains which will make as many as 453 additional trips to cater to the festival rush,a DMRC spokesman said.

On Diwali day,Metro service will start as usual at 6 am and the last Metro train service will start at 8 pm from terminal stations of all the six lines.

The terminal stations are Dilshad Garden,Rithala,Jahangir Puri,Huda City Centre,Noida City Centre,Dwarka Sector-21,Yamuna Bank,Anand Vihar,Inderlok,Mundka,Central Secretariat and Sarita Vihar,the spokesman said.

Usually,metro services close at 11 pm.

“In view of the expected rise in the number of commuters using the Delhi Metro ,DMRC will run 33 extra trains on all lines,thus making 453 extra trips,” the spokesman said.
